Mental Health Services We Offer

Our Oakview Behavioral Health Services are located in Middleburg Heights, OH. We focus on successful outcomes and the development of self-awareness, self-acceptance and personal responsibility.

Services we provide include:

  • Assessment Services – These services are the first step in determining the existence of a mental health or substance abuse disorder. Treatment recommendations are made after a comprehensive assessment of psychiatric, physical, addictive and mental health issues. Emergency assessments are available 24 hours a day through Southwest General's Emergency Department. Non-emergency assessments may be scheduled during regular business hours by calling 440-816-8200.
  • Addiction ServicesOakview Behavioral Health Services is fully accredited by Joint Commission and licensed as an addiction treatment center by the state of Ohio. The Center features a multidisciplinary clinical team and a highly successful back-to-basics approach to help adults recover from substance abuse. Family involvement is highly encouraged.
  • Mental Health Services –Comprehensive services for inpatient and outpatient treatment of patients with metal health disorders. Features a variety of treatment methods and therapeutic activities.

Additionally, Southwest General offers a Geriatric Behavioral Health Unit on the Main Campus in Middleburg Heights. This program focuses on the special needs of older adults with acute psychiatric and behavioral issues.
